The indicator is an Interapid 312B-2 dial test indicator with 0.0005" resolution and goes for about $200 today. The plate & V blocks I made out of plate 6061 aluminum, but anything to hold the indicator and V blocks will do.I modified a C clamp to let me use the indicator to check shafts and such on the heli. I can also check the main shaft on the heli with this.

i replace my shafts every time i crash. but for me i can make any size shaft for less than $1.75. i made a jig and i go to the local industrial supply store, spend a whopping $5.50 on a 3 foot oil hardened 10mm shaft and i cut them down to legnth then insert an original copy in the jig to set the position of the holes then just shove a new shaft in the jig and i can spit out brand new shafts in no time, no matter what the make of heli is, for dirt cheap and in some cases my shafts are even higher tolerance than the factory ones.only way ill ever make the jack is if i work at a cheese factory |
